Abstract

The invention discloses a parking space guiding and reverse vehicle searching system and a method. The parking space guiding and reverse vehicle searching system comprises a parking space and licence plate identifying and positioning device and an inquiry terminal, wherein the parking space and licence plate identifying and positioning device further comprises a center data server, a licence plate identifying computer, a site controller, a guiding screen, a parking space lamp and a camera, wherein the center data server is connected with a vehicle identifying computer by an Ethernet, the licence plate identifying computer is connected with the site controller by the Ethernet, the site controller is connected with the camera, the parking space lamp and the guiding screen, and the center data server is also connected with the inquiry terminal by a wired network or a wireless network. By adopting the technical scheme disclosed by the invention, a parking space guiding system and a reverse vehicle searching system can be combined into a whole; and moreover, the structure is simple, the manufacturing cost is low, and the problems of parking difficulty, vehicle searching difficulty and the like are also solved effectively.

Of the present invention mainly being differentiated the empty full state in parking stall with the mode of video image identification; The method identification number-plate number with image recognition; The parking stall guides and oppositely seeks truck system and unites two into one, and hundreds of parking stalls have a car plate identification computing machine, have reduced system cost.Vehicle location need not be swiped the card, and the motorist just can accomplish vehicle location without waste motion, carries out the fuzzy matching inquiry through inputting license plate number, and sign the best is sought the bus or train route line.
Fig. 1 is parking stall guiding and the structural representation of oppositely seeking truck system in the specific embodiment of the invention.As shown in Figure 1; This system comprises parking stall car plate identification positioning device 1 and inquiry terminal 201; Parking stall car plate identification positioning device further comprises central server 101, car plate identification computing machine 102, field controller 103, parking stall lamp 104, camera 105 and navigational panel 106; The centre data server via Ethernet connects the vehicle identification computing machine of lower floor; Car plate identification computing machine is through the field controller of Ethernet connection lower floor, and field controller connects camera, parking stall lamp and navigational panel, and inquiry terminal is connected with the centre data server through Ethernet.The centre data server also is connected through wired network or wireless network with inquiry terminal.
Wherein, Field controller connects camera and parking stall lamp, and it comprises an embedded DSP singlechip controller, is mainly used in the extracting of image scene picture and uploads; Optional wherein one tunnel video image compression becomes the IP form to upload; The empty full state in parking stall is judged in calculating, and drives the parking stall lamp with the empty full state in red green demonstration parking stall, uploads on-the-spot each equipment running.The centre data server is obtained the parking stall vectoring information from the upper strata, issues parking space guide screen nearby and shows zone, empty wagons position, accomplishes the parking stall guiding function.Each field controller can be controlled 8 road cameras and parking stall lamp at most, can satisfy between two pillars in general parking lot 6 or 8 parking stall and cover, and controls 2 parking space guide screens at most.It is AV signal format that field controller connects camera; Connecting parking stall lamp switch signal drives; Connect navigational panel and use the RS-485 communications protocol, upwards connect car plate identification computing machine and adopt the Ethernet ICP/IP protocol, the ICP/IP protocol that upwards connects can be a wired network; Also can use wireless network Wifi agreement, can save the wiring trouble.
Car plate identification computing machine is used to discern the vehicle pictures number-plate number of extracting, and uploads to the centre data server to the number-plate number, parking stall coding, the empty full state in parking stall and vehicle pictures etc.Car plate identification computing machine generally is installed on the on-the-spot wall or on the pillar nearby, also can be installed in the management pulpit, and it according to the time requirement of car plate Data Update, can control a plurality of field controllers through the field controller of Ethernet connection lower floor.As the time requirement 10 seconds that refreshes car plate data fully, then chassis board identification computing machine can be controlled about 200 parking stalls; If refresh time extends to 20 seconds, then control parking stall quantity and can be increased to about about 400.Car plate identification computing machine requires computing power stronger, requires again to be fit to work on the spot, generally adopts the industrial computer of four nuclear CPU, and built-in car plate identification software can not wanted peripheral hardwares such as display and keyboard after debugging finishes.In order to shorten the time delay of car plate identification, system can preferentially discern processing to the vehicle of up-to-date entering parking stall automatically, and to the vehicle taking turn processing that vehicle is come in and gone out and changed does not take place, so can not cause too many time delay.The identification number-plate number; Use rapid artificial intelligent algorithm, can improve the accuracy rate of car plate identification and the accuracy rate of multiframe continuous videos stream identification, the whole board recognition accuracy of vehicle is greater than 90%; Back 5 bit digital recognition accuracies are greater than 97%, and single frames picture recognition time is less than 25 milliseconds.
Centre data server operated by rotary motion is in the management pulpit, and it is the core of total system, is mainly used in to refresh and storage cart item, the number-plate number, empty full state, vehicle pictures etc.; According to the empty full state computation parking space guide screen in parking stall to show the empty wagons figure place, and be handed down to field controller; According to the request of inquiry terminal, issue inquiry terminal to the car item of the corresponding number-plate number, vehicle pictures etc., supply client's enquiring vehicle position to use.The management maintenance work of system comprises management car plate identification computing machine, field controller, inquiry terminal etc., carries out the parameter setting, passes under program, data and the map etc. etc.
The empty full identification in parking stall realizes through field controller; Guaranteed the real-time of parking stall identification and parking stall guiding; The state of parking stall lamp shows basic not free the delay, because field controller and centre data server adopt the TCP/IP communications protocol, communication speed is much higher than the RS-485 bus again; The Data Update time of total system shortened more than 90% than ultrasound wave parking stall identification commonly used now less than 1 second.
Car plate identification is operated on the car plate identification computing machine and realizes that more than 200 above parking stall has a computing machine and Vehicle License Plate Recognition System software, reduced the cost of system.The good framework of this system has solved the contradiction of performance and cost well, lays the foundation for system reduces cost.
Inquiry terminal is made up of the inquiry terminal of band liquid crystal touch screen, and there are multimedia output apparatus such as sound at the terminal, and outward appearance fashion is easy to use, and operated by rotary motion gets into the parking lot only way which must be passed personnel such as the lift port of buildings, stair mouth, halls.It is connected with centre data server via Ethernet ICP/IP protocol, can be wired network, also can be wireless network Wifi.Its information of vehicles and electronic chart through calling the centre data server on liquid crystal touch screen, show the vehicle exact position, and sign is sought the car best route.Seek the bus or train route line and indicate with map and navigation way, route and the step that also can seek car with literal and speech explanation, easy to use.When the motorist returns when picking up the car, only need the number-plate number of input oneself on touch-screen, or indivedual numerals of the number-plate number; System will carry out fuzzy matching to the similar number-plate number; Show a plurality of number-plate numbers and vehicle pictures on touch-screen, after the motorist browses, select correct information of vehicles; Locate the vehicle of oneself fast, system provides subsequently seeks the bus or train route line.Can not find car in the time of can preventing the car plate identification error or misremember car plate with the method for fuzzy matching.
The all right expanded function of inquiry terminal; As print Query Result and seek bus or train route line chart, self-help charging (system will and support to swipe the card payment, mobile-phone payment etc. with the stopping charging system networking), idle period playing advertisements, inquiry market and the briefing of mansion, the consumption reward voucher in printing market etc., can expand according to actual conditions.
Inquiry terminal and system have accomplished together and have oppositely sought the car function, and it is easy to use that this seeks the car function, do not need motorist's unnecessary action request such as swipe the card, and have overcome the positioning system of swiping the card and have forgotten and swipe the card and can not find the difficult problem of car.Equally; Owing to be the camera in a parking stall; So the number-plate number and parking stall strictness are corresponding one by one; Even indivedual parking stalls are arranged, also can, next round fill when refreshing, so can not cause the corresponding wrong slippage errors problem of parking stall and vehicle owing to there be blocking of vehicle, pedestrian not catch the number-plate number.
Fig. 2 is a camera installation site synoptic diagram in the specific embodiment of the invention.As shown in Figure 2, camera is used to take parking stall and vehicle image, requires advantages of small volume, is fit to the low-light (level) use, generally is installed in the passage opposite of parking stall.The parking stall lamp also will be installed in the next door of camera, and parking stall one side and camera that the parking stall lamp then is installed in passage are just in time opposite; Be used to indicate the full state of sky of this parking stall, generally use LED lamp group, represent that the parking stall is full, the car state is arranged with redness; Green parking stall sky, the no car state represented; The blue disabled person parking stall of representing, the predetermined RESERVED of green flicker representative etc., function can define flexibly.Navigational panel is the empty wagons bits number that is used for showing respective regions, and convenient in order to connect networking, parking space guide screen is connected with the field controller on next door nearby, obtains video data.
